12. Virtually no pay can be negotiated
A quick read reveals that merit, performance, overtime and other pay cannot be negotiated. Only base pay can be negotiated and that is limited to a COLA increase or less.

Plus, it doubles as a right to work law. You no longer have to pay dues. Who will pay union dues for a union that cannot negotiate? No one.

Except for public safety, the state and municipal unions are done in Wisconsin.
